Software Transactional Memory: The Best Concurrency Model You (Probably) Aren’t Using

If you’re reading this blog post, I’m sure you’ve come across the concept of ACID in databases. Database operations happen in transactions, which act as a single unit ensuring that everything succeeds completely or fails entirely with no partial effects.…


